Before we evaluate the myths and assumptions of science, lets take a moment to investigate what science is and can do. In order to consistently make advancements, science needs a reliable methodology and reproducible results (162). Scientists plan out their experiments very carefully, making sure start off with a good hypothesis (162). A suitable hypothesis consists of at least five elements: it is relevant, testable, compatible with established hypotheses, has explanatory or predictive power, and is relatively simple (163-164). Relevance means that the hypothesis in question actually explains something; it must be proposed for a discernable purpose (163). Testability is generally considered to be the primary demarcation between science and non-science; there must be a component that is open to being measured using scientific instruments (163). While it is true that in the past there have been occasions when a new theory supplanted an older one, in general a scientific hypothesis must be consistent with other hypotheses that are well tested and accepted by the scientific community (163). A good hypothesis also must be useful for deducing, or predicting, new phenomena and explaining older phenomena (164). The simplicity of a theory means that all parts of the hypothesis are essential to the theory; all things being equal, the simpler of two hypotheses is preferred over the more complex (164).

Science has several basic assumptions that, together with methodology, help to define what science is able to do. The assumptions are that there is order in nature, uniformity in nature, and singularity of causes (166). Scientists assume that the universe is structured in a coherent intelligible way, such that it is possible to find patterns and regularities. Nature is assumed to be uniform in that any law observed to be in effect on the Earth is also in effect throughout the entire universe (166). Singularity of causes refers to the principle that for every effect or event in the universe there is only one cause for that effect (166-167). If any of these three assumptions prove to be untrue, then science utterly collapses. These assumptions along with scientific methodology are what propelled science to the heights that it currently enjoys. Since the methodology and assumptions of science have to do with deducing and quantifying the make-up of the physical universe, science does a very good job of providing answers to the questions ‘what is it?’ and ‘what does it do?’

In spite of the great successes of science and the strong deductive ability of science for exploring the universe, science has some rather severe limits. Because the scientific method is only able to deal with the tangible physical universe, it is unable to investigate any aspect of the cosmos that is purely spiritual or non-physical in its essential nature (168). Another limitation is that historically science has proceeded in fits and jumps as opposed to a steady rate (168). This uneven advancement of science is due to the fact that there is no steering mechanism, no formulaic way for science to consistently advance at a set pace (168-169). Often, scientists proceed with their work without ever considering models outside of their particular field (169-170). This results in a general inability of scientists to take relevant information from a different field of science and apply it to a particular problem (170). One of the more important limitations of science is the fact that science is unable to make judgments about what ought to be done (170-171). In other words, science can only tell us what ‘is’ not what ‘ought to be’ and is silent when it comes to moral, aesthetic, or social issues.
